Job Overview
Develop and implement quality plan, budget, policies and systems; and supervise quality assurance activities with the objective of ensuring TE's product quality meet customers and external agencies' standards within corporate headquarter quality systems, policies and procedures; and relevant local regulations.
People Management
What your background should look like:
- Lead the quality control department, , Allocate and balance work across direct reports; review and provide timely performance feedback to direct reports; mentor, develop and motivate them; guide resolve tough people/functional issues in the team; submit manpower application; interview candidates and provide feedback to achieve the section performance target, retain and develop key talent.
- Assure compliance to requirements and optimization of process capabilities to ensure product quality,customer service,and cost effectiveness.
- Lead the team to reduce DPPM, customer complaints, customer returns values and quality cost.
- Check the department policies and initiate the policy change, prepare the related materials, and follow up and monitor the policy execution.
- To ensure the procedures and policies in line with corporate standards are well executed
- Communicate with functional teams and prepare the department budget and work plan annually, and compare the expenses with the budget monthly; summarize the result, analyze, and report to the department director to propose a practical department budget and conduct effective control.
- Approve the internal/external deviation requests and 4M changes; organize monthly manager internal audit; monitor the DPPM performance, and coordinate activity to improve DPPM.
- Approve the supplier classification and the critical claims to manage supplier quality within the required standards.
- Periodically review the in-process quality targets and quality cost, and initiate quality meetings to resolve the critical quality issues in order to ensure in-process quality meet required standards and reduce quality problems within the production in-process.
- Review and approve the quality-related document as a working instruction, inspection plan, evaluate deviation risk, and monitor the execution.
- Guide the engineers to solve on-site quality issues and take preventive actions; help to solve cross-functional issues and evaluate and balance the quality, delivery, and cost in order to solve quality issues timely manner and prevent similar cases from happening.
- Lead problem-solving of supplier-related defects, lead supplier improvement initiatives, analyze manufacturing and supply chain quality data, and lead the problem-solving activities.
- Initiate and monitor the monthly cross audit, review the results, and follow up on the corrective actions; review the department's 6 sigma improvement monthly; and monitor the engineers' conduct daily quality improvement to drive the continuous quality improvement
- Prepare the operation performance report
- Collect and analyze the quality-related data, and report to the DND BU Quality Team a timely and accurate report to management and related parties.
- Bachelor's degree
- Major in engineering
- 8 ~ 10 years working experience in the quality area, including 2 years of people management
- Effective bilingual
- Negotiation skills
- Teamwork
- Logical thinking
- Pressure management skills
